As I lifted the KRUPS Simply Brew 5-Cup Coffee Maker out of the box, I immediately noticed its sleek, stainless steel exterior—feels solid but not heavy, perfect for a small kitchen or office countertop. Its compact size means it doesn’t take up much space, yet it has a surprisingly sturdy feel.
The first thing I appreciated was how straightforward it is to use. The simple on/off button, combined with the top-fill water tank, makes setup quick and hassle-free.
I filled it with water, added the included measuring spoon to the reusable filter, and watched it brew—no complicated menus or settings to worry about.
One feature I loved is the Pause & Brew function. You can easily pour a cup mid-brew without dripping or making a mess.
The carafe’s no-drip spout stayed clean, and I could enjoy a fresh cup before the rest finished brewing. The Keep Warm function worked well, keeping my coffee hot for about half an hour without losing flavor.
Cleaning is a breeze. The stainless steel exterior wipes down easily, and the glass carafe along with the reusable filter are dishwasher safe.
It’s perfect for occasional use—small enough to store away when not needed but reliable enough to deliver fresh, hot coffee whenever you want it.
Overall, this coffee maker hits the right notes for a quick, simple coffee experience. It’s not packed with fancy features, but that’s part of its charm.
It’s ideal for singles, couples, or small households who want a reliable brew without fuss.

The moment I saw how easily the Keurig K-Express fit on my countertop, I knew it was built with convenience in mind. Its compact size means you don’t need a big kitchen space to enjoy a quick coffee fix.
Plus, the simple button layout makes brewing feel almost effortless, even during those groggy mornings.
The standout for me was the three cup sizes—8, 10, or 12 ounces. It’s perfect for customizing your coffee strength without fiddling with complicated settings.
The 42oz water reservoir is a game-changer, letting you brew up to four cups before needing a refill, which saves time and trips to the sink.
The brew itself is quick, taking just minutes from start to finish, which is ideal when you’re in a rush. I appreciated the ability to brew a stronger cup with the “Strong Brew” setting—great for those mornings when you want your caffeine to really kick in.
The removable drip tray is a thoughtful touch, easily accommodating travel mugs up to 7.4 inches tall.
Using it with the reusable filter was straightforward, giving me the option to use ground coffee and cut down on waste. The auto-off feature is handy, automatically turning off after five minutes, so you don’t have to worry about leaving it on.
Overall, it’s a reliable, fuss-free machine that’s perfect for occasional coffee drinkers like me who want a quick, fresh brew without the bells and whistles.

Many folks assume that a small coffee maker like this is just a basic device with limited functions. But after using the Kismile 5-Cup Drip Coffee Maker, I found it surprisingly versatile and thoughtfully designed for occasional coffee lovers.
The first thing that caught my attention is the LED display with a 12-hour timer. It’s super easy to set up, and the clear buttons make programming a breeze—perfect for mornings when you want your coffee ready without fiddling around.
The compact size is a real plus if you’re tight on counter space. It weighs just about 1kg, yet it brews a decent amount—up to 5 cups—so you’re not stuck with tiny servings.
Plus, the glass pot and funnel are dishwasher safe, making cleanup after a lazy weekend simple and quick.
The anti-drip system is a game-changer. I spilled less than usual, and it kept my countertop tidy.
The auto shut-off after 2 hours is reassuring, especially if you’re forgetful or in a rush.
Build quality feels solid, and the food-grade materials give peace of mind about safety. The one-button operation is straightforward—no confusing settings, just press and brew.
It’s ideal for those occasional coffee moments when you want a quick, hassle-free brew without fussing over complicated features.
Overall, this coffee maker delivers convenience, safety, and decent performance in a small package. It’s perfect for small kitchens, offices, or anyone who drinks coffee now and then but wants a reliable, easy-to-use machine.

The first thing I noticed when I lifted the Keurig K-Mini off the counter was how surprisingly lightweight it felt. It’s less than 5 inches wide, so I expected it to be tiny, but I was impressed by how sturdy the build feels in your hand.
I set it on my cramped kitchen shelf, and it practically disappeared in the space, which is perfect for small apartments or offices.
Using it for the first time was a breeze. I filled the single reservoir with fresh water, chose my favorite 8oz K-Cup, and pressed brew.
The machine heated up quickly, and in just a few minutes, I had a hot, fresh cup of coffee. The removable drip tray made it easy to slip in my travel mug, which I appreciated because I often grab coffee on the go.
The adjustable brew size from 6 to 12oz really gives flexibility. I liked that I could customize my cup without fuss.
The auto-off feature kicked in after a minute or so of inactivity, which I found handy for saving energy. Plus, it’s compatible with reusable filters if you want to try ground coffee, though I stuck with K-Cups for convenience.
Overall, this little machine makes a perfect occasional brew buddy. It’s simple, fast, and fits seamlessly into tight spaces.
Just don’t expect it to handle heavy use—it’s ideal for when you want a quick coffee fix without any fuss.
